#1d4bc0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d4bc0 is composed of 11.4% red, 29.4%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.9% cyan, 60.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 223.1 degrees, a saturation of 73.8% and a lightness of 43.3%. #1d4bc0 color hex could be obtained by blending #3a96ff with #000081. Closest websafe color is: #3333cc.

#1d4bc0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d4bc0 has RGB values of R:29, G:75,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0.61, Y:0,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 1919936.
